Making a limited URL services is an interesting undertaking that consists of a variety of components of software program improvement, which includes Internet development, databases administration, and API layout. Here's an in depth overview of The subject, which has a deal with the vital elements, challenges, and best practices involved with building a URL shortener.

1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way online through which a long URL is often converted right into a shorter, a lot more manageable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the original long UR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-acknowledged exam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media platforms like Twitter, the place character limits for posts designed it tough to share extensive URLs.

Outside of social media, URL shorteners are valuable in promoting strategies, e-mail, and printed media exactly where extended URLs could be cumbersome.

2. Main Factors of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ily is made of the subsequent factors:

Website Interface: This is the front-stop element in which consumers can enter their lengthy URLs and obtain shortened variations. It could be an easy type on a Online page.
Database: A database is necessary to keep the mapping in between the original prolonged URL plus the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L selections like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that can take the limited URL and redirects the consumer to the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is normally carried out in the online server or an application lay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ners deliver an API making sure that 3rd-get together program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original extensive URLs.
3. Creating the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a protracted URL into a short one particular. A number of strategies could be employed, such as:

Hashing: The lengthy URL can be hashed into a hard and fast-dimensions string, which serves since the quick UR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(unique URLs resulting in precisely the same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ular common method is to work with Base62 encoding (which uses sixty two people: 0-nine,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ds for the entry from the database. This technique ensures that the small URL is as limited as feasible.
Random String Era: Another tactic is always to generate a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six people) and Examine if it’s by now in use inside the database. If not, it’s assigned towards the extended URL.
4. Database Management
The database schema for any URL shortener is usually easy, with two Principal fields:

ID: A singular identifier for each URL entry.
Prolonged UR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The shorter version in the URL, typically saved as a singular string.
In combination with these, you might like to retail outlet metadata such as the development date, expiration day, and the volume of instances the brief URL has actually been accessed.

5.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ection can be a critical part of the URL shortener's operation. Every time a person clicks on a brief URL, the provider ought to immediately retrieve the first URL in the databases and redirect the user working with an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) standing code.

General performance is vital right here, as the procedure need to be virtually inst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often employed to speed up the retrieval system.

six. Security Things to consider
Security is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to unfold destructive back links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party protection solutions to check UR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Price restricting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A huge number of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it may need to deal with numerous UR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, potentially invol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ic throughout many servers to take care of significant lo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ners generally prov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, where the traffic is coming from, as well as other useful metrics. This necessitates log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
